Как программные продукты проходят апдейты
Актуальное программное обеспечение существует в постоянном совершенствовании. Ежедневно миллионы клиентов принимают уведомления о готовых апдейтах для своих софта, системного ПО и веб-сервисов. Процесс формирования и развертывания модификаций составляет сложную ступенчатую структуру, которая охватывает проектирование, программирование, проверку и запуск свежих возможностей и фиксов.
Обновления программного обеспечения являются ключевой частью жизненного цикла любого цифрового продукта On X. Они гарантируют надежность, производительность и современность программ, адаптируя их к трансформирующимся потребностям пользователей и технологическому прогрессу.
С какой целью в принципе издавать апдейты и что они обеспечивают
Апдейты ПО служат множественным принципиально значимым функциям. Первостепенная миссия – предоставление цифровой безопасности. Цифровые опасности трансформируются постоянно, и создатели обязаны быстро устранять обнаруженные уязвимости, которые могут быть задействованы киберпреступниками для незаконного проникновения к информации пользователей.
Ликвидация ошибок и недочетов в программном коде составляет существенную долю апдейтов on x casino. Даже при том что самое скрупулезное проверка не в состоянии предотвратить все потенциальные проблемы, которые возникают в живой среде эксплуатации приложения огромным количеством юзеров с различными настройками железа и программного окружения.
Улучшение скорости и оптимизация функционирования программ позволяют более продуктивно задействовать системные ресурсы. Создатели постоянно находят методы осуществить свои продукты скорее, не такими ресурсоемкими к ОЗУ и вычислительным ресурсам, что принципиально для мобильных устройств с урезанными ресурсами.
Интеграция свежих возможностей и возможностей помогает цифровому приложению сохраняться конкурентоспособным на площадке. Клиенты рассчитывают регулярного возникновения новых инструментов и усовершенствований, которые упростят их деятельность или предоставят новые возможности для креатива и результативности.
Приспособление к свежим нормам и технологиям предоставляет интеграцию программы On-X с эволюционирующей инфраструктурой. Это охватывает работу с новых форматов файлов, сетевых технологий, операционных систем и аппаратных платформ.
Как собирают фидбек и находят неполадки
Аккумулирование обратной связи от пользователей составляет базовым механизмом для выявления проблем и установления направлений развития цифрового приложения Он Икс Казино. Нынешние компании применяют разнообразные каналы для добывания данных о функционировании своих программ в реальных условиях.
Автоматические системы мониторинга аккумулируют деперсонализированные информацию о быстродействии, регулярности применения различных функций, времени отклика UI и возникающих ошибках. Эта информация способствует обнаружить наиболее сложные зоны приложения и понять, какие опции действительно нужны клиентами.
Отделы сопровождения юзеров постоянно обрабатывают огромное количество заявок, жалоб и рекомендаций. Квалифицированные специалисты исследуют приходящие обращения, категоризируют их по типам проблем и отправляют данные отделам создания для продолжающегося анализа и ликвидации.
Отслеживание онлайн-платформ, обсуждений и специализированных сообществ способствует определить коллективную оценку о софте и обнаружить проблемы, которые клиенты дискутируют между собой, но не сообщают напрямую разработчикам.
Предварительное испытание с привлечением энтузиастов из числа активных пользователей дает возможность протестировать новые функции в разнообразных обстоятельствах использования до их публичного релиза. Бета-тестеры часто находят проблемы, которые не были выявлены внутренними отделами контроля качества.
Зачем дополнительный функционал проектируют предварительно
Стратегирование свежих возможностей предварительно представляет жизненно необходимым аспектом результативной программирования программного обеспечения On X. Стратегическое программирование дает возможность отделу создания фокусироваться на приоритетных целях и предоставить координацию всех частей решения:
- Изучение сферы и соперников помогает установить популярные функции и технологические тренды.
- Анализ средств и временных расходов позволяет объективно планировать масштаб деятельности.
- Структурное планирование гарантирует взаимодействие дополнительного функционала с текущей кодовой базой.
- Координация между разными командами разработки избегает столкновения и повторение работы.
- Обеспечение платформы и инструментов разработки для поддержки дополнительных опций.
- Планирование испытания и контроля качества свежих возможностей.
- Подготовка документации и учебных ресурсов для клиентов.
Перспективное проектирование также помогает управлять предположениями пользователей и партнеров. Публичные планы развития совершенствования приложения формируют прозрачность в связях с клиентами и дают возможность им планировать собственные проекты с учетом грядущих модификаций в ПО.
По какой причине актуализации сначала испытывают на малой выборке
Поэтапное развертывание апдейтов начинается с небольшой аудитории юзеров On-X по нескольким критичным причинам. Регулируемое тестирование в живых обстоятельствах способствует обнаружить проблемы, которые не были обнаружены во время корпоративного испытания в контролируемых обстоятельствах.
Ограниченная выборка испытателей позволяет уменьшить вероятный урон в случае обнаружения опасных сбоев. Если модификация имеет опасные проблемы, они повлияют на лишь малую долю юзеров, что заметно уменьшает имиджевые и экономические риски для организации.
Мониторинг быстродействия и стабильности решения под нагрузкой настоящих клиентов дает более адекватную понимание подготовленности обновления к повсеместному использованию. Внутренние тесты не всегда способны повторить все вероятные сценарии использования софта.
Получение информации задействования свежих возможностей помогает осознать, насколько они интуитивны и нужны для пользователей. Изучение поведения пробной аудитории способствует внести завершающие коррективы в пользовательский интерфейс и возможности перед общедоступной публикацией.
Поэтапное внедрение способствует ступенчато увеличивать часть юзеров Он Икс Казино, принимающих обновление, отслеживая критичные параметры быстродействия и число уведомлений о сбоях на каждом этапе увеличения аудитории.
Как устраняют ошибки до выпуска и после него
Система устранения сбоев в софтверных решениях обладает разные методы в соответствии от фазы создания продукта. На фазе предрелизного проверки команда разработки обладает увеличенный период и средств для тщательного изучения и ликвидации неполадок.
Платформы мониторинга багов системы помогают структурировать систему обработки выявленных ошибок. Каждая трудность имеет индивидуальный код, описание имитации, категорию серьезности и назначается отвечающему разработчику для устранения.
Ранжирование сбоев основывается на их воздействии на юзеров и устойчивость решения. Опасные баги защиты и сбои, вызывающие к утрате информации или краху софта, ликвидируются в первоначально. Эстетические трудности пользовательского интерфейса могут быть перенаправлены до будущего выпуска.
После-выпускные модификации требуют повышенной осторожности и скорости отклика. Срочные патчи разрабатываются для ликвидации опасных проблем, которые не в состоянии дожидаться регулярного обновления. Подобные исправления проходят ускоренное проверку и мгновенно внедряются среди пользователей.
Автономное развертывание исправлений позволяет быстро передавать патчи защиты всем юзерам On X без нужды их прямого взаимодействия в процессе актуализации. Это особенно важно для устранения серьезных уязвимостей, которые могут быть применены киберпреступниками.
Каким способом обновления воздействуют на совместимость и стабильность
Эффект модификаций на взаимодействие софтверных решений представляет одним из наиболее сложных факторов разработки. Обратная совместимость гарантирует возможность новой версии программы оперировать с сведениями, созданными в предыдущих версиях, без исчезновения функциональности или информации.
Перспективная интеграция позволяет устаревшим итерациям приложения использовать документы, разработанные в свежих редакциях, хотя отдельные дополнительные опции могут быть недоступны. Программисты часто задействуют целевые механизмы для сохранения предельной интеграции между версиями.
Надежность платформы в состоянии на время падать после внедрения модификаций из-за трансформаций в построении приложения или взаимодействии с другими частями решения. Регрессионное испытание помогает выявить случаи, когда новые изменения нарушают функционирование имеющихся функций.
API-совместимость жизненно необходима для программ, которые взаимодействуют с иными программами или платформами. Изменения в системах взаимодействия должны быть детально документированы и, по мере сил, реализованы с сохранением обратной совместимости.
Перенос данных при модификациях нуждается особых процедур для преобразования сведений из прежнего стандарта в современный. Самостоятельные преобразователи помогают пользователям On-X комфортно мигрировать на новую версию приложения без утраты собранных данных.
Зачем важно мочь восстанавливать обновления
Способность возврата модификаций является критически важной функцией надежности для всякой механизма регулирования софтверными решениями. Даже при самом скрупулезном тестировании обновленные итерации софта в состоянии содержать сбои, которые обнаруживаются только в определенных условиях использования.
Самостоятельные системы отката дают возможность оперативно восстановиться к прежней стабильной версии программы в случае нахождения опасных неполадок. Это критично для системного ПО, где длительность сбоя вынуждено являться минимальным.
Снапшоты платформы формируются перед установкой апдейтов, предоставляя точку восстановления с комплексным статусом приложения и сведений. Современные платформы виртуализации и контейнеризации значительно облегчают механизм генерации и восстановления снапшотов.
Градуальный откат способствует ступенчато возвращать пользователей к прежней редакции софта, контролируя систему и сокращая эффект на работу решения. Это особенно важно для крупных распределенных систем Он Икс Казино с огромным количеством пользователей.